  • Qwak!'s instance of is recorded as video game[3].
  • Qwak!'s genre is recorded as shooter game[4].
  • Qwak!'s genre is recorded as light-gun shooter[5].
  • Qwak!'s developer is recorded as Atari[6].
  • Qwak!'s platform is recorded as arcade video game machine[7].
  • Qwak!'s input device is recorded as light gun[8].
  • Qwak!'s country of origin is recorded as United States[9].
  • Qwak!'s publication date is recorded as +1974-00-00T00:00:00Z[10].
